Built-In Protection Functions

The included 10A solar charge controller offers comprehensive protection features to safeguard your battery and system. These include protection against overcharge  •  deep discharge  •  overload (at 1.05 times rated discharge)  •  short circuit (at 2 times rated discharge)  •  reverse polarity  •  and overheating. It also prevents reverse current flow from the battery back to the solar panels during the night, ensuring optimal system safety and longevity.

Common Questions

What type of batteries can this kit charge?

This kit's 10A charge controller is compatible with 12V or 24V sealed, gel, and flooded lead-acid batteries. It features automatic voltage selection for convenience.

Is this kit suitable for permanent outdoor installation?

Yes, the two 20W polycrystalline solar panels feature robust, waterproof designs with sealed aluminium frames, making them ideal for permanent outdoor use in various weather conditions.

What is the purpose of the 10A charge controller?

The 10A PWM charge controller protects your battery from overcharging and deep discharging, which helps to extend its lifespan. It also prevents reverse current flow from the battery to the panels at night.

Can I expand this system with more solar panels?

The included 10A controller can handle up to 160W of solar input for a 12V battery system or 320W for a 24V system. You could add more panels up to this limit, ensuring they are compatible with the controller's voltage and current ratings.

Installation Notes

  • Always connect the 12V or 24V battery to the controller's battery terminals first.
  • Next, connect the solar panels to the controller's solar terminals.
  • Ensure the charge controller is installed in a well-ventilated area.
  • Allow 1.0 to 1.5cm clearance behind solar panels for adequate cooling.
  • Refer to the supplied user manual for detailed wiring diagrams and instructions.
